Russian, French and American leaders are crisscrossing Africa to win support for their positions on the war in Ukraine, waging what some say is the most intense competition for influence on the continent since the Cold War.

Russian foreign minister Sergei Lavrov and French President Emmanuel Macron are each visiting several African countries this week.
